Digital Transformation in the Food Industry

Digital transformation in the food industry refers to the use of technology to improve the way food is produced, marketed, and distributed. It encompasses the use of digital tools, such as artificial intelligence (AI), the Internet of Things (IoT), and big data, to enhance the food industry's efficiency, productivity, and profitability.

Production

Digital transformation has had a significant impact on food production. It has enabled food manufacturers to improve the efficiency of their production processes, reduce waste, and increase the quality of their products. This is achieved through the use of smart machines and AI, which can optimize the production process by adjusting variables such as temperature, humidity, and pressure.

In addition, digital technology has made it easier for food manufacturers to track the origin and quality of their ingredients. This is important for ensuring that the food is safe and of high quality. With the help of blockchain technology, food manufacturers can track the entire supply chain, from the farm to the consumer, and ensure that the food is produced and distributed in a sustainable manner.

Marketing

Digital transformation has also had a significant impact on the way food is marketed. It has opened up new channels for food manufacturers to reach their customers, such as social media, e-commerce platforms, and mobile apps. This has enabled them to engage with their customers more effectively and offer personalized marketing campaigns.

Furthermore, digital technology has made it easier for food manufacturers to collect and analyze data about their customers. This allows them to understand their customers' preferences and behavior and tailor their marketing efforts accordingly.

Consumption

Digital transformation has changed the way food is consumed. It has enabled consumers to access a wider variety of food options and has made it easier for them to make informed decisions about the food they consume. For example, food delivery apps have made it easier for consumers to order food from their favorite restaurants and have it delivered to their doorstep.

In addition, digital technology has made it easier for consumers to access information about the nutritional value and ingredients of the food they consume. With the help of mobile apps, consumers can scan the barcodes of food products and receive information about their nutritional value, ingredients, and allergens.

Challenges and Opportunities

While digital transformation has brought about significant benefits to the food industry, it has also created new challenges. One of the main challenges is the need for skilled workers who can manage and maintain the technology. Additionally, the implementation of digital technology requires a significant investment, which may not be feasible for smaller food manufacturers.

Challenges and Opportunities

However, the opportunities that digital transformation presents to the food industry are vast. It has the potential to increase the efficiency and productivity of the industry, reduce waste, and improve the quality of food products. Moreover, it enables food manufacturers to reach a wider audience and offer personalized marketing campaigns.
